Natasha Babies Boutique
Profile
Natasha Babies Boutique is a baby, baby clothing, child, children clothing, children's clothing, clothing, infant's clothing company located at Toronto, Canada,address is 1181 St Clair Ave W,Zipcode is M6E 1B5, Contact by Tel: 4166542232
Map
Google Map of Natasha Babies Boutique address:1181 St Clair Ave W,Toronto,Canada.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.